Jim is incredible. This company goes above and beyond for their clients . Extremely reliable !Highly recommended if you looking for top tier service and to have things taken care of right away.
June 2024
I was wary when my local oil company was bought by Petro but have been pleasantly surprised by their services. I had issues with my boiler and they were promptly responsive. The techs that have serviced the boiler were pleasant and informative. I then reached out to Petro for a quote for mini splits ( my third quote) and they were less expensive and had electricians so I didn't have to find one on my own. From my first interaction with Steven Smith sales to the plumber and electrician signing off on the one day installation it has all been positive and exceeded my expectations. I am so happy that I decided to go ahead with the install and given the perfect timing... read full review
May 2024
Been a loyal customer for 20 years. Time to look around for another one. You book an appointment and are told a certain time frame. They never call to say they are running late. You need to reach out to them. Then they quote another time and call back and say that they are now running late again. Get ready to waste a whole day waiting for someone to show up! Excuse is there were emergencies. OFC. Customer service and managers don't care either. Time to move on when contracts are up.
Jim is incredible. This company goes above and beyond for their clients . Extremely reliable !Highly recommended if you looking for top tier service and to have things taken care of right away.
I was wary when my local oil company was bought by Petro but have been pleasantly surprised by their services. I had issues with my boiler and they were promptly responsive. The techs that have serviced the boiler were pleasant and informative. I then reached out to Petro for a quote for mini splits ( my third quote) and they were less expensive and had electricians so I didn't have to find one on my own. From my first interaction with Steven Smith sales to the plumber and electrician signing off on the one day installation it has all been positive and exceeded my expectations. I am so happy that I decided to go ahead with the install and given the perfect timing... read full review
Been a loyal customer for 20 years. Time to look around for another one. You book an appointment and are told a certain time frame. They never call to say they are running late. You need to reach out to them. Then they quote another time and call back and say that they are now running late again. Get ready to waste a whole day waiting for someone to show up! Excuse is there were emergencies. OFC. Customer service and managers don't care either. Time to move on when contracts are up.